1. A pacemaker connector block assembly for use with an implantable pacemaker and an implantable bipolar pacemaker lead;

  • said bipolar pacemaker lead having a proximal end that includes at least two spaced-apart electrodes, a first of which is substantially non-deformable when subjected to a holding force, and a second of which is easily deformable when subjected to a holding force of the same magnitude as that applied to the first electrode, said pacemaker having electrical circuits therein to which the first and second proximal electrodes are to be electrically connected, said connector block assembly comprising;

    a receiving channel for receiving the proximal end of said bipolar pacemaker lead, including said first and second spaced-apart electrodes;

    first contact means within said receiving channel for applying a first holding force to said first electrode and for maintaining electrical contact therewith;

    second contact means within said receiving channel for applying a second holding force to said second electrode and for maintaining electrical contact therewith, said second contact means including force limiting means internal to said connector block assembly for limiting the amount of the second holding force that can be applied to said second electrode to a value that prevents deformation of said second electrode;

    means for electrically connecting said first and second contact means with the electrical circuits within said pacemaker; and

    sealing means for preventing body fluids from contacting said first and second contact means when the proximal end of said bipolar pacemaker lead is inserted into said receiving channel;

    whereby the proximal end of said bipolar pacing lead may be removably and sealably inserted into said connector block assembly.
